BS:Crude palm oil down 0.2% on low demand
 
Crude palm oil extended losses for the fourth straight session and prices fell further by 0.29% to Rs 554 per 10 kg in futures trading today due to sluggish demand in the spot market.

At the Multi Commodity Exchange, crude palm oil for delivery in February shed Rs 1.60, or 0.29% to Rs 554 per 10 kg in business turnover of 24 lots.

Likewise, the oil for delivery in January traded lower by Rs 1.50, or 0.27% to Rs 550.40 per 10 kg in 36 lots.

Analysts said subdued demand in the spot market against adequate stocks position in the physical market mainly kept pressure on crude palm oil prices for the fourth day at futures trade.
